Mark McNairy made a name for himself by turning up the volume (and sometimes adding some pretty colorful language) to the staples that guys love: oxford shirts with permanent lipstick kisses on the collars, boldly striped shorts, and camouflage everything. But his latest collection, New Republic by Mark McNairy, distills the kinds of shoes you'd wear from 9 to 5 down to their purest and most attractive forms.

The new line, which McNairy is making in partnership with Five Four (an affordable subscription service that sends you a box of new clothes every month), will be available starting Tuesday, July 12. While the shoes for his designer line, Mark McNairy New Amsterdam, can command prices of $500 or more, the New Republic shoes will retail for between $58 to $98. And Five Four subscribers will be able to purchase them for 25 percent off. The lineup includes everything from longwing brogues, loafers, laceups, and bucks to the all-important driving moc.

"I looked at this project as if it was a collaboration with Target or H&M," said McNairy, who's collaborated with Five Four before, in an interview with WWD. "I agreed to do the collaboration because it's going to put my name into the heads of 50,000 guys when they get my monthly package. The stuff never goes into a store. It goes straight to the consumer. So it's not competing with my regular collection."
